Children will have missed large parts of their EYFS educational entitlement. What does this mean for transition?

Although a proportion of the September 2020 year 1 cohort will have benefited from a return to their reception classes this summer it is obvious that the year group has suffered a significant disruption. The EYFSP was not recorded in 2020 but common sense suggests that this year we will not have the majority of children attaining Early Learning Goals and a Good Level of Development as they leave reception and therefore provision in Year 1 will need to be modified. In any case, the firm foundations that the EYFS provides will have been only partially built and we need to continue that building throughout Year 1. We can achieve this in a more holistic way than simply carrying on ‘like Reception’ until Christmas!
